Effectiveness and cost-effectiveness of an electronic mindfulness-based intervention (eMBI) on maternal mental health during pregnancy: the mindmom study protocol for a randomized controlled clinical trial.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Mental disorders are common during the peripartum period and may have far-reaching consequences for both mother and child. Unfortunately, most antenatal care systems do not provide any structured screening for maternal mental health. As a consequence, mental illnesses are often overlooked and not treated adequately. If correctly diagnosed, cognitive behavioral therapy is currently the treatment of choice for mental illnesses. In addition, mindfulness-based interventions (MBIs) seem to represent a promising treatment option for anxiety and depression during the peripartum period. Considering the internet's increasing omnipresence, MBIs can also be offered electronically via a (tablet) computer or smartphone (electronically based MBI = eMBI).

OBJECTIVE

The current study aims to examine the clinical effectiveness and cost-effectiveness of an eMBI (the mindmom application) developed by an interdisciplinary team of gynecologists, psychologists, and midwives, teaching pregnant women how to deal with stress, pregnancy-related anxiety, and depressive symptoms. The study sample consists of pregnant women in their third trimester who screened positive for emotional distress. The mindmom study is a bicentric prospective randomized controlled trial (RCT), which is currently conducted at the University women's hospitals of Heidelberg and Tübingen, Germany.

METHODS

Within the scope of the routine prenatal care, pregnant women attending routine pregnancy care in Baden-Wuerttemberg, Germany, are invited to participate in a screening for mental distress based on the Edinburgh Postnatal Depression Scale (EPDS). Women with an EPDS screening result > 9 will be referred to one of the mindmom coordinating study centers and are offered counseling either face-to-face or via videotelephony. After an initial psychological counseling, women are invited to participate in an eMBI in their last pregnancy trimester. The study will enroll N = 280 study participants (N = 140 per group), who are randomized 1:1 into the intervention (IG) or control group (treatment as usual = TAU). All participants are requested to complete a total of 7 digital assessments (5 visits pre- and 2 follow-up visits postpartum), involving self-report questionnaires, sociodemographic and medical data, physiological measures, and morning cortisol profiles. The primary outcome will be depressive and anxiety symptoms, measured by the Edinburgh Postnatal Depression Scale, the State Trait Anxiety Questionnaire, and the Pregnancy-Related Anxiety Questionnaire. Secondary outcomes include mindfulness, satisfaction with birth, quality of life, fetal attachment, bonding, mode of delivery, and cost-effectiveness.

DISCUSSION

This is the first German RCT to examine the (cost-)effectiveness of an eMBI on maternal mental health during pregnancy. If successful, the mindmom app represents a low-threshold and cost-effective help for psychologically distressed women during pregnancy, thereby reducing the negative impact on perinatal health outcome.

摘要

背景

精神障碍在围产期很常见,可能对母婴都有深远的影响。不幸的是,大多数产前保健系统都没有对产妇的心理健康进行任何结构化的筛查。因此,精神疾病经常被忽视,得不到充分治疗。如果得到正确诊断,认知行为疗法目前是治疗精神疾病的首选。此外,基于正念的干预措施(MBIs)似乎是围产期焦虑和抑郁的一种很有前途的治疗选择。考虑到互联网的普及程度不断提高,MBIs 也可以通过平板电脑或智能手机进行电子干预(电子 MBI=eMBI)。

目的

本研究旨在评估由妇科医生、心理学家和助产士组成的跨学科团队开发的电子 MBI(mindmom 应用程序)的临床效果和成本效益,该应用程序教授孕妇如何应对压力、与怀孕相关的焦虑和抑郁症状。研究样本由在第三个孕期筛查出情绪困扰的孕妇组成。mindmom 研究是一项双中心前瞻性随机对照试验(RCT),目前在德国海德堡和图宾根的大学妇女医院进行。

方法

在常规产前护理的范围内,邀请在德国巴登-符腾堡州接受常规妊娠护理的孕妇参加基于爱丁堡产后抑郁量表(EPDS)的精神困扰筛查。EPDS 筛查结果>9 的妇女将被转介到一个 mindmom 协调研究中心,并提供面对面或视频电话咨询。经过初步的心理咨询后,妇女被邀请在最后一个孕期参加电子 MBI。该研究将招募 280 名研究参与者(每组 140 名),并将他们随机分为干预组(IG)或对照组(常规治疗=TAU)。所有参与者都需要完成总共 7 次数字评估(5 次就诊前和 2 次产后随访),包括自我报告问卷、社会人口学和医学数据、生理测量和晨皮质醇图谱。主要结果将是抑郁和焦虑症状,通过爱丁堡产后抑郁量表、状态特质焦虑问卷和妊娠相关焦虑问卷来衡量。次要结果包括正念、分娩满意度、生活质量、胎儿依恋、联系、分娩方式和成本效益。

讨论

这是德国第一项研究电子 MBI 对妊娠期间产妇心理健康的(成本)效果的 RCT。如果成功,mindmom 应用程序将为怀孕期间心理困扰的女性提供一种低门槛、具有成本效益的帮助,从而减少对围产期健康结果的负面影响。
